Synthetic Biology in Agriculture Market to Reach USD 71.9 Bn by 2032 on Biotechnology Adoption Surge

The Synthetic Biology in Agriculture Market Size is projected to grow from USD 4.3 billion in 2023 to USD 71.9 billion by 2032 at a 36.9% CAGR, driven by biotech advances in crop traits, sustainability, and food security.
By: Acumen Research
 
CLAYTON, Del. - Feb. 27, 2026 - PRLog -- Synthetic Biology in Agriculture Market is poised for remarkable global expansion as biotechnology continues to transform farming, crop enhancement, and sustainable agricultural practices. According to latest Synthetic Biology in Agriculture Market Report by Acumen Research and Consulting, global Synthetic Biology in Agriculture Market Size was valued at USD 4.3 billion in 2023 and is projected to reach USD 71.9 billion by 2032, growing at an impressive compound annual growth rate (CAGR) of 36.9% from 2024 to 2032.

Synthetic Biology in Agriculture Market Statistics

According to Synthetic Biology in Agriculture Market Analysis:
  • Market Size (2023): USD 4.3 billion
  • Forecast Market Value (2032): USD 71.9 billion
  • CAGR (2024–2032): 36.9%
  • Largest Regional Share: North America — approx. USD 1.68 billion in 2023
  • Fastest-Growing Region: Asia-Pacific — projected to grow at ~38% CAGR
  • Key Growth Drivers: Rising investments in agricultural biotechnology research, sustainable farming demand, and crop productivity challenges

Synthetic Biology in Agriculture Market Trends & Analysis

Synthetic Biology in Agriculture Market Trends reveal ongoing transformation of modern farming:
  • Precision Genetic Engineering: Genome editing tools such as CRISPR and metabolic engineering are enabling tailored crop traits, making plants more resistant to pests, diseases, and climate stress.
  • Bio-Based Inputs: Synthetic biology facilitates bio-based fertilizers and pesticides that reduce dependency on chemical inputs, supporting ecological balance and soil health.
  • Sustainable Crop Production: As environmental concerns rise, biotech solutions offer sustainable ways to improve yields without harming the ecosystem.
  • Rising Funding & R&D: Increased investments from governments and private sectors in biotech research strengthen innovation pipelines and accelerate market adoption.
Key Market Drivers

Several powerful forces are driving Synthetic Biology in Agriculture Market Growth:
  • Rising global food demand due to population growth and changing consumption patterns.
  • Need for sustainable agriculture that balances productivity with ecological preservation.
  • Advanced genetic tools that allow precise, efficient crop improvements.
  • Government and private sector R&D investment in agricultural biotechnology research.
